+void rx01_device::command_write(uint16_t data)
+{
+ printf("command_write %04x\n",data);
+ m_unit = BIT(data, 4);
+ m_interrupt = BIT(data, 6);
+
+ m_image[m_unit]->floppy_drive_set_ready_state(1, 0);
+
+
+ if (BIT(data, 14)) // Initialize
+ {
+ printf("initialize\n");
+ m_state = RX01_INIT;
+ }
+ else if (BIT(data,1)) // If GO bit is selected
+ {
+ m_rxcs &= ~(1 << 5); // Clear done bit
+ m_buf_pos = 0; // Point to start of buffer
+ switch ((data >> 1) & 7)
+ {
+ case 0: // Fill Buffer
+ m_rxcs |= (1 << 7); // Set TR Bit
+ m_state = RX01_FILL;
+ break;
+ case 1: // Empty Buffer
+ m_state = RX01_EMPTY;
+ break;
+ case 2: // Write Sector
+ case 3: // Read Sector
+ case 6: // Write Deleted Data Sector
+ m_rxes &= ~(1 << 6 | 1 << 1 | 1 << 0);// Reset bits 0, 1 and 6
+ m_state = RX01_SET_SECTOR;
+ break;
+ case 4: // Not Used
+ m_state = RX01_COMPLETE;
+ break;
+ case 5: // Read Status
+ m_state = RX01_COMPLETE;
+ m_rxdb = m_rxes;
+ break;
+ case 7: // Read Error Register
+ m_state = RX01_COMPLETE;
+ // set ready signal according to current drive status
+ m_rxes |= m_image[m_unit]->floppy_drive_get_flag_state(FLOPPY_DRIVE_READY) << 7;
+ break;
+ }
+ }
+ m_command_timer->adjust(attotime::from_msec(100));
+}
